Geological models

The type of geological model needed depends on the stage of the project. We develop  2D and 3D engineering geological models for all stages of the project life-cycle. Model types include:

  • Concept geological models – using pre-existing information and experiences of similar materials in similar settings.
  • Initial engineering geology models – where the above is supplemented with some limited site data.
  • Detailed engineering geology models – incorporating the findings of investigation campaigns.
  • Geotechnical/analytical models – the model is adapted for use in analysis/design, defined ‘units’ of similar engineering characteristics and expected behaviour.

The characteristics of the data available are important.   Key data characteristics include:

  • Quality – how the available data conforms to modern standards/methods.
  • Reliability we have in the data available – is it right or wrong or do we just not know?
  • Representativeness – does the data show the actual material characteristics (e.g. is enough information available? Is there a sampling bias present?).

Foundations and construction materials

Dam foundation characterisation includes:

  • Bearing and deformability.
  • Abutment and foundation failure mechanisms – such as sliding or wedge failure.
  • Liquefaction susceptible soils.
  • Internal erosion (piping) susceptible materials.
  • Founding levels  – establishing the geological criteria for this.
  • Required foundation preparation and treatment.
  • Foundation permeability and pressures, geological controls on uplift, foundation drain efficiency.

Dam construction material services, for both embankment and concrete dams, include:

  • Identifying borrows and quarry locations, and their likely available volumes.
  • Processing requirements to achieve the required specification.
  • Identify undesirable characteristics – such as those related to durability, reactivity, dispersivity and erodibility.
  • Spoil disposal.

Operation

During dam operation, our dam geology services include:

  • Safety inspections and reviews – such as Comprehensive Dam Safety Reviews (CDSRs) in New Zealand and 20-year Dam Safety Reviews (DSRs) in Australia.
  • Failure Mode Effects Analysis (FMEA) – identifying credible vs non-credible geological-based Potential Failure Modes (PFMs).
  • Comprehensive Risk Assessments (CRA) and Portfolio Risk Assessments (PRA)– identifying factors that make the identified PFMs more or less likely, quantifying geological uncertainty and knowledge gaps.
  • Technical studies to address identified dam safety recommendations – such as new investigations.
  • Condition surveys.
  • Monitoring and surveillance advice – those related to geological-based PFMs.
